From November 2023, there will be new subscription models at Disney Plus, one of which is also partially financed by advertising. Still, the introduction of the new subscription options is ultimately a hidden price increase.

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, WOW and Disney+ – when the inevitable GEZ fees are added on top, the monthly expenditure on entertainment media can be quite high. Those who would like to save a little on Disney+ can rejoice – from November 1, 2023, the streaming service of the Mouse House will offer three new models, including an option co-financed by advertising. But beware, ultimately this is also a hidden price increase.

In addition to a standard subscription, which will cost you 8.99 euros a month (or 89.90 euros if you pay annually), there will also be an ad-financed and a premium variant in the future.

Although you will have to reckon with interruptions during the streams in the lowest-cost model, this variant will only cost 5.99 euros a month. Both the advertising savings package and the standard subscription allow two simultaneous streams, which can be streamed in Full HD, i.e. up to 1080p.

If you opt for the Premium version, you can not only have four streams running in parallel, but you can also watch your shows in 4K UHD and HDR. You can also access Dolby Atmos for the audio output, while the other streams only have stereo 5.1 sound. For these advantages, however, you’ll have to dig deeper into your pocket, the whole thing will then cost you 11.99 euros per month – or 119.90 euros if you decide to take out an annual subscription right away.

THE NEW SUBSCRIPTION MODELS ARE A HIDDEN PRICE INCREASE

If you are already a Disney+ customer, nothing will change for you for the time being. In Germany, users* will keep their current monthly and annual subscription at the existing price through November 1 – of course, Disney reserves the right to change this in the future. Your current subscription will automatically be renamed to “Premium,” but you can easily revert to the ad-supported model.

Ultimately, this is a hidden price increase: The services that were previously included in the regular subscription for 8.99 euros will cost new customers 11.99 euros per month in the future. Disney+ last increased its prices on February 23, 2021. Previously, Disney+ cost 6.99 euros a month.

In addition, the streaming service wants to take stronger action against account sharing in the future. Netflix has led the way, now the other streaming providers are following suit. As Disney CEO Bob Iger announced at a balance sheet meeting on August 9, 2023, they are currently examining ways to best take action against account sharing.
